Psalms 119:16 Bible Commentary

Commentary on Psalms 119:16

Bible Verse: "I will delight myself in thy statutes: I will not forget thy word." - Psalms 119:16

Introduction

Psalms 119 is the longest chapter in the Bible, celebrated for its profound meditation on the Word of God. This particular verse encapsulates a crucial attitude towards scripture: the dual commitment to delight in God’s law and to actively remember His word. This commentary draws insights from several well-known public domain commentaries to enrich the understanding of this verse for pastors, students, theologians, and Bible scholars.

Delight in God's Statutes

Matthew Henry emphasizes the importance of delighting in God's statutes. He explains that true delight comes from a heart that is transformed by an understanding of God’s character and His commands. This joy in God's word is not merely emotional; it speaks to a deep respect and personal investment in the divine teachings.

This delight is a choice—it reflects a decision to find joy in what God has prescribed for us. Henry points out that those who delight in the statutes of the Lord find strength and guidance in their spiritual walk. They glean that obedience to God’s law is not burdensome, but rather a source of satisfaction and joy.

Memory as a Spiritual Discipline

Albert Barnes provides further reflection on the second half of the verse: “I will not forget thy word.” He underscores the necessity of actively committing God’s word to memory, recognizing it as a vital aspect of spiritual life. Memorization ensures that God’s truths are readily available during times of trial, decision-making, and temptation.

Barnes notes the imperative nature of this practice: without intentional efforts to remember, believers can easily drift away from the teachings that sustain them. Thus, the act of remembering highlights a dynamic relationship with the scripture that is cultivated through regular reading, reflection, and prayer.

The Interconnection of Delight and Memory

Adam Clarke articulates the close connection between delighting in God’s statutes and the act of remembering His word. He suggests that true delight leads to a more profound remembrance, as the heart that finds joy in scripture will naturally retain it more readily. Clarke posits that the law of God becomes a treasure to those who cherish it, making the experience both personal and communal.

Moreover, Clarke emphasizes that this verse reveals the holistic approach needed towards scripture: it should be engaged with both intellectually and emotionally. The essence of worship is reflected in this verse, as it calls for a heartfelt response to God’s commandments, merging love with commitment.
